Javascript

¿Qué es JavaScript y para qué sirve? Link to heading

Introducción Link to heading

JavaScript es un lenguaje de programación fundamental para el desarrollo web moderno. Te permite añadir interactividad, dinamismo y funcionalidades avanzadas a tus páginas web, mejorando la experiencia del usuario.

Origen Link to heading

Nació en 1995 con la necesidad de hacer que las páginas web, originalmente estáticas, fueran más dinámicas e interactivas. Permitió a los usuarios interactuar con la web y entre sí, abriendo un nuevo mundo de posibilidades.

Características clave Link to heading

  • Interpretado: Se ejecuta directamente en el navegador, sin necesidad de compilación previa.
  • Orientado a objetos: Facilita la organización y reutilización del código.
  • Débilmente tipado: Permite realizar operaciones entre tipos de datos distintos.
  • Dinámico: Se puede modificar el código durante la ejecución.

Ventajas de JavaScript: Link to heading

  • Fácil de aprender: Su sintaxis es relativamente sencilla, lo que facilita su aprendizaje.
  • Versátil: Se puede usar para una amplia variedad de aplicaciones web.
  • Potente: Permite crear funcionalidades complejas e interactivas.
  • Amplia comunidad: Cuenta con una gran comunidad de desarrolladores que crean recursos y herramientas constantemente.

Aplicaciones de JavaScript: Link to heading

  • Desarrollo web: Se utiliza para crear aplicaciones web dinámicas, interactivas y con funcionalidades avanzadas.
  • Desarrollo de aplicaciones: Permite crear aplicaciones nativas para Android, iOS, macOS y Windows.
  • Backend: Node.js permite usar JavaScript para el desarrollo del lado del servidor.
  • Internet de las cosas (IoT): Se puede usar para crear aplicaciones que conectan objetos cotidianos a internet.

Ejemplos de uso de JavaScript: Link to heading

  • Animaciones: Crear animaciones y transiciones en páginas web.
  • Juegos: Desarrollar juegos web simples o complejos.
  • Mapas interactivos: Mostrar mapas con información dinámica.
  • Validación de formularios: Verificar la información ingresada por los usuarios.
  • Peticiones AJAX: Intercambiar datos con el servidor sin necesidad de recargar la página.

Conclusión: Link to heading

JavaScript es un lenguaje de programación esencial para el desarrollo web moderno. Es versátil, poderoso y fácil de aprender, lo que lo convierte en una herramienta indispensable para cualquier desarrollador web. Si quieres crear páginas web interactivas y dinámicas, JavaScript es la herramienta ideal para ti.

Recuerda: Link to heading

La comunidad de JavaScript es enorme y está en constante crecimiento. Hay una gran cantidad de recursos disponibles para ayudarte a aprender JavaScript. No dudes en comenzar a aprender JavaScript hoy mismo y descubre las posibilidades que te ofrece.

¡Empieza a explorar el mundo de JavaScript y descubre todo lo que puedes crear!